Recently, Dogecoin's performance has indeed been eye-catching. Its price has been continuously rising, driven by social media hype and retail investor enthusiasm. In contrast, the gains of ApeCoin and PENGU appear somewhat dull, and this contrast has sparked some interesting market phenomena.



Why does such a divergence occur? On one hand, as a pioneer Meme coin, Dogecoin has stronger brand recognition and a solid community base. When market sentiment improves, investors tend to flock back to these classic assets. On the other hand, new Meme coins need time to build their ecosystem and buzz, and during this process, they are inevitably overlooked by the market.

From an investment perspective, this trend signals that market enthusiasm for Meme coins is recovering, but investors still prefer more established and liquid options. The lag of APE and PENGU does not mean they are permanently out of the game; Meme coin trends often feature rotation, and today's laggards may make a comeback in the next wave of market movement.

However, it is important to note that Meme coins are highly volatile, and their short-term price performance is influenced by multiple factors, including market sentiment, social media hype, and liquidity. Investors should carefully assess risks before investing and avoid over-concentrating funds in a single asset.
